RS Group plc announces that, Non-Executive Director, Louisa Burdett will step down as Chair of the Audit Committee with effect from 15 July 2025. She will continue to be a member of the Audit Committee and in her other Board roles. Carole Cran will succeed Louisa as Chair of the Audit Committee with effect from 15 July 2025.
Carole joined the Board on 1 December 2024 as a Non-Executive Director and has been a member of the Audit Committee since her appointment. Carole is a chartered accountant and is currently chief financial officer of Halma plc.
RS Group plc is a United Kingdom-based company, which is a global omni-channel provider of product and service solutions for designers, builders and maintainers of industrial equipment and operations. The Company's segments include EMEA, Americas and Asia Pacific. It stocks more than 750,000 industrial and electronic products, sourced from over 2,500 suppliers, and provides a range of product and service solutions to customers. Its product solutions include automation and control; mechanical and fluid power; electronics; maintenance, and safety and protection. Its service solutions include design solutions, customer order solutions, procurement solutions, inventory solutions, maintenance solutions, safety solutions, integrated supply solutions and ESG solutions. RS PRO is its own-brand product range. Its OKdo brand is a technology solutions business focused on single-board computing (SBC), Internet of Things (IoT) and education. Better World is its sustainable product range.
